Writing component unit tests with bUnit

We have seen the basic tests written by default in the bUnit template. In this section, we will start creating our own tests. We’ll write a test for the ModalPopup component we developed in the Developing templated components section in Chapter 3, Developing Advanced Components in Blazor.

Writing the first component unit test

ModalPopup is a good starting point for us as it doesn’t have dependencies and it has some parameters, so we can learn how to pass parameters to a CUT.

Let’s get started:

  1. In the BooksStore.Tests project, add the BooksStore namespaces needed inside _Imports.razor so we don’t need to reference them in each test file we have:
    ...@using BooksStore.Shared@using BooksStore.Models@using BooksStore.Services
  2. Create a new Razor component and name it ModalPopupTests.razor.
  3. Remove any markup and make the component inherit from the TestContext class:
    @inherits TestContext@code {}
